'Rings of Power' Showrunner Responds To Criticisms Over The Pace of Season One

The ladies of The Lord of the Rings: The Rings of Power looked amazing at the show’s panel during the 2022 PaleyFest NY held at Paley Museum on Saturday (October 8) in New York City.

Cynthia Addai-Robinson, Nazanin Boniadi, and Sara Zwangobani joined their co-stars Benjamin Walker, Daniel Weyman, Charles Edwards, and Leon Wadman at the event, just a few days after attending the show’s panel during NYCC.

During the weekend of events, showrunner J.D. Payne addressed criticisms that the show’s pacing was too slow.

He told The Hollywood Reporter that the pacing throughout the first season is about just right: “I hope that people can key in for the journey.”

“A lot of blockbusters have a breakneck pace where you’re wheeled from one set piece to the next until it all collapses under its own weight,” he continued. “Tolkien will take his time and let you sink into characters, to a journey, and journeys can be hard in Tolkien. I hope people will have the patience to settle in for a Tolkien epic.”
